What companies run services between Mannheim, Germany and Lourdes, France?

You can take a train from Mannheim, Hauptbahnhof to Lourdes via Offenburg Bahnhof, Offenburg, Paris Est, Gare de l'Est, Montparnasse Bienvenue, and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2 in around 10h 27m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Mannheim central bus station to Lourdes via Bordeaux in around 22h.
